Strip the Noise, Keep the Signal

Look: a team’s power‑play percentage can swing wildly month to month, but over a 20‑game stretch it stabilizes. Forget the flash‑in‑the‑pan injuries that never make the stat sheets. Focus on Corsi, Fenwick, zone starts – the metrics that survive the noise.

Why Traditional Stats Fail

Goals? A fickle beast, subject to puck luck and goaltender hot‑streaks. Shooting percentage? A 0.2% swing can flood a line with profit or wipe it clean. Use underlying possession metrics, not surface-level box scores.

Money Management – The Real Guardrail

Here is the deal: never stake more than 2% of your bankroll on a single game. A 0.5% flat‑rate unit keeps you in the game when a cold streak hits. Adjust units monthly, not weekly.

Bankroll Discipline

When you win, reinvest just a slice. When you lose, cut the next bet in half. This simple arithmetic slashes variance faster than any fancy model.
